17+ /* *
18+ * This stress-test is self-contained reproducer for the race in [Flow.asPublisher] extension
19+ * that was originally reported in the issue
20+ * [#2109](https://github.com/Kotlin/kotlinx.coroutines/issues/2109).
21+ * The original reproducer used a flow that loads a file using AsynchronousFileChannel
22+ * (that issues completion callbacks from multiple threads)
23+ * and uploads it to S3 via Amazon SDK, which internally uses netty for I/O
24+ * (which uses a single thread for connection-related callbacks).
25+ *
26+ * This stress-test essentially mimics the logic in multiple interacting threads: several emitter threads that form
27+ * the flow and a single requesting thread works on the subscriber's side to periodically request more
28+ * values when the number of items requested drops below the threshold.
29+ */
